A web developer can be a web designer, but it requires acquiring distinct creative skills alongside technical expertise.
Understanding the Roles: Developer vs. Designer
The question “Can A Web Developer Be A Web Designer?” often arises because these roles overlap yet remain fundamentally different. At the core, a web developer focuses on the technical side of building websites—writing code, managing databases, and ensuring functionality. On the other hand, a web designer is primarily concerned with aesthetics, user experience (UX), and crafting visually appealing layouts.
Web developers write in languages like HTML, CSS, JavaScript, and backend languages such as Python or PHP. Their job is to make sure the site works smoothly and efficiently. Designers use tools like Adobe XD, Sketch, or Figma to create wireframes and mockups that guide the look and feel of the site.
While there’s crossover—developers often tweak design elements and designers need to understand development constraints—the skill sets are distinct. Developers think logically and structurally; designers think creatively and visually.
Skills That Separate Developers From Designers
To see why combining these roles can be challenging, let’s break down their core competencies:
- Web Developers: Coding languages (JavaScript, HTML/CSS), debugging, responsive design implementation, backend integration.
- Web Designers: Color theory, typography, layout principles, UX/UI design strategies, graphic design software proficiency.
Developers excel at problem-solving through code; designers excel at crafting intuitive interfaces that engage users emotionally.
The Overlap: Where Development Meets Design
Despite differences, many professionals wear both hats—especially in smaller teams or freelance settings. This overlap is possible because modern web development encourages collaboration between design and coding.
For example:
- A developer might adjust CSS stylesheets to improve visual alignment.
- A designer might prototype interactive elements using basic HTML/CSS.
- Both roles require understanding responsive layouts for mobile devices.
This synergy means learning some design basics benefits developers immensely. Conversely, designers who grasp front-end coding can create more feasible designs.
Why Some Developers Transition to Design
Developers often become interested in design after realizing how crucial good UX is for project success. The appeal lies in:
- Creative freedom: Design offers artistic expression beyond logical coding tasks.
- User impact: Crafting interfaces directly influences how users perceive a brand or product.
- Career flexibility: Adding design skills opens doors to roles like UX/UI specialist or product designer.
This transition isn’t automatic—it demands dedication to mastering new tools and principles far removed from coding logic.
Key Challenges When Switching From Developer to Designer
The biggest hurdles developers face when moving into design include:
- Creative mindset shift: Moving from structured problem-solving to open-ended creativity can be tough.
- Lack of formal art training: Understanding color theory or typography often requires study beyond self-teaching code.
- User empathy development: Designers must deeply understand user needs and behaviors—something not always emphasized in development roles.
Overcoming these challenges requires focused learning and practice in visual arts alongside user psychology.
The Learning Curve: Tools & Techniques
Developers who want to become designers should familiarize themselves with:
| Design Aspect | Recommended Tools | Description |
|---|---|---|
| User Interface (UI) Design | Figma, Sketch, Adobe XD | Create wireframes and mockups for website layouts and components. |
| User Experience (UX) Research | Miro, Optimal Workshop | Conduct user testing and map user journeys for better usability. |
| Graphic Design & Visuals | Adobe Photoshop, Illustrator | Edit images and create icons or logos used in web projects. |
Mastering these tools helps developers bridge the gap toward professional-level design work.
The Benefits of Combining Development & Design Skills
When a professional masters both disciplines, they gain several advantages:
- Smoother workflows: Understanding both sides reduces communication gaps between teams.
- Easier prototyping: They can build functional prototypes without waiting on other specialists.
- Better quality control: They spot usability issues early during development phases.
- Diverse career opportunities: Hybrid skills open paths in startups or agencies needing versatile talent.
Such dual expertise is especially prized in agile environments where speed and adaptability matter most.
The Downsides of Wearing Both Hats Simultaneously
Despite perks, juggling both roles comes with drawbacks:
- Time-consuming skill maintenance: Keeping up with evolving coding frameworks and design trends demands constant effort.
- Lack of deep specialization: Being a jack-of-all-trades risks becoming master of none if not managed carefully.
- Poor role clarity: Confusion over responsibilities can arise within teams expecting clear-cut duties.
Balancing these factors is key to successfully blending web development with web design.
The Industry Perspective: What Employers Think
Hiring managers often prefer specialists but value hybrid professionals for certain projects. Here’s how they view candidates on this spectrum:
| Candidates Type | Main Strengths | Main Limitations |
|---|---|---|
| Pure Developer | Coding expertise; backend logic; performance optimization. | Lacks visual creativity; limited UX insight. |
| Pure Designer | Aesthetic sense; UX focus; creative problem-solving related to interface design. | No coding skills; relies on developers for implementation details. |
| Hybrid Developer-Designer | Smooth collaboration; prototype creation; flexible skillset covering many stages of production. | Might lack deep mastery in either area; risk of burnout juggling tasks. |
In startups or small agencies especially, hybrid professionals are gold because they reduce hiring overhead while maintaining quality output.
The Path Forward: How To Become Both Developer And Designer?
If you’re asking “Can A Web Developer Be A Web Designer?” here’s a practical roadmap:
- Evolve Your Mindset: Embrace creativity alongside logic. Start appreciating visual details around you daily—colors, fonts, layouts—and analyze why they work well (or don’t).
- Learnthe Fundamentals Of Design Theory: Study basics like color theory, typography rules, grid systems. Online courses from platforms like Coursera or Udemy offer structured content tailored for beginners transitioning from tech backgrounds.
- Dabble With Design Software: Get hands-on experience using Figma or Adobe XD by replicating existing websites’ designs or creating your own concepts from scratch. Practice makes perfect!
- Create Side Projects Combining Both Skills: Build personal websites where you handle both front-end development and UI/UX design decisions. Iteration helps refine your dual abilities over time.
- Solve Real User Problems: Conduct simple usability tests among friends/family for your designs. Feedback teaches empathy—a vital trait for any designer—even if your roots lie in programming logic.
- Pursue Certifications Or Bootcamps Focused On UX/UI Design: Structured programs accelerate learning curves by offering mentorship plus portfolio-building projects that impress employers looking for hybrid talents.
- Keeps Skills Updated Regularly: Both fields evolve fast—follow blogs like Smashing Magazine (design) and CSS-Tricks (development) to stay current with best practices on both fronts without losing ground on either side.
Key Takeaways: Can A Web Developer Be A Web Designer?
➤ Skills overlap but differ in focus and tools.
➤ Developers build functionality; designers craft visuals.
➤ Learning both enhances versatility and job prospects.
➤ Collaboration between roles improves project outcomes.
➤ Continuous learning is key to mastering both fields.
Frequently Asked Questions
Can a web developer be a web designer by learning creative skills?
Yes, a web developer can become a web designer by acquiring creative skills such as color theory, typography, and UX design principles. This combination allows them to handle both the technical and aesthetic aspects of building websites effectively.
Can a web developer be a web designer without formal design training?
While formal training helps, many developers learn design through practice and using tools like Adobe XD or Figma. Understanding basic design concepts and user experience can enable developers to create visually appealing sites without formal education.
Can a web developer be a web designer in small teams or freelance work?
In smaller teams or freelance environments, it’s common for developers to take on design tasks. This dual role helps streamline projects, but it requires balancing coding expertise with creative design skills to meet client needs.
Can a web developer be a web designer by focusing on front-end technologies?
Focusing on front-end technologies like HTML, CSS, and JavaScript helps developers bridge the gap between development and design. These skills enable them to implement responsive layouts and tweak visual elements directly in the code.
Can a web developer be a web designer by understanding user experience (UX)?
Understanding UX is crucial for developers aiming to become designers. It guides how users interact with websites, allowing developers to create intuitive interfaces that enhance usability and engagement beyond just coding functionality.